Output e138c73f46e827ada130f1dc29009a2c23a199b83c457109162a0aacc27e77c8:0

value
1020166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a79294d698ab5a68cfec10f4e16c09addea4ac OP_EQUAL
address
322LhGQfNGZveK21TC2wKRpDSjyr51akPN
transaction
e138c73f46e827ada130f1dc29009a2c23a199b83c457109162a0aacc27e77c8
confirmations
385940
spent
true